buying a house

A real estate attorney is needed any time problems arise regarding the purchase of a home. Common problems include:

– Buy a repossessed house

– Back taxes owed by the previous owner

– Problems with contracts.

– Signing of documents

– Price negotiation.

You don’t want to be stuck with the liability for back taxes from a previous owner, or have your agreed-upon lease go awry. If you’re buying a foreclosed home, you want to make sure you meet all the deadlines, so the bank or financial institution that owns the property doesn’t cancel your purchase. Having an attorney by your side can help ensure that everything runs smoothly when buying a new home, especially when unexpected financial problems arise. They can help you with documents, help you with any court cases that may arise, and protect you throughout the home buying process.

How to deal with your own foreclosure

A home is foreclosed on when the owner misses multiple mortgage payments in a row. The bank or financial institution that holds title to your property will do everything they can to recover your loan, which may leave you, as a financially struggling homeowner, without a place to live. It can be scary and frustrating to deal with on your own, which is why a real estate attorney can be so helpful.

An attorney can review your past payments and creditworthiness, and talk to your bank about working out a payment plan that could end a foreclosure already in progress. If foreclosure is already in progress, they can help you set a time frame to vacate your home, giving you the opportunity to find a new place to live. They can also help you find new properties to buy, even if you have a negative mark on your credit report due to foreclosure.
